Ogdensburg man brandishes knife at Walmart

Monday, May 24, 2021 - 1:21 pm OGDENSBURG - Harlow Perry, Jr., 44, Ogdensburg man was charged Sunday with second-degree robbery and fourth-degree criminal possession of weapon stemming from an incident at the Ogdensburg Walmart. On the afternoon of May 23 at about 2:30 p.m. the Ogdensburg Police Department responded to a report of a theft at Walmart, located at 3000 Ford Street Extension. While investigating the incident, it is alleged that Harlow brandished a knife when he was confronted about the theft by store employees. Witnesses provided information that ultimately led to the identification and arrest of Harlow. Perry was arraigned in Ogdensburg City Court and was remanded without bail to the St. Lawrence County Correctional Facility.

Ogdensburg men charged in kidnapping scheme that prompted lockout at schools

Ogdensburg men charged in kidnapping scheme that prompted lockout at schools William Larock and Michael Larock (Source: WWNY) By Diane Rutherford | May 19, 2021 at 2:54 PM EDT - Updated May 19 at 5:58 PM OGDENSBURG, N.Y. (WWNY) - A father and son face charges in connection with a kidnapping scheme involving 2 Ogdensburg school children. City police arrested 51 year old William Larock and his 33 year old son, Michael Larock, both of 504 Canton Street in Ogdensburg. Police said the men targeted a family - threatening to kidnap 2 children if the family didn’t pay the Larocks an undisclosed sum of money. Lieutenant Mark Kearns of the Ogdensburg Police Department said the family and the Larocks know each other. He declined to comment on a motive.

Ogdensburg police arrest 2 men, seize crack cocaine and cash

Ogdensburg police arrest 2 men, seize crack cocaine and cash Thomas Troche and Harry Martinez (Source: WWNY) By 7 News Staff | May 4, 2021 at 2:58 PM EDT - Updated May 4 at 4:01 PM TOWN OF OSWEGATCHIE, N.Y. (WWNY) - A traffic stop in St. Lawrence County ended with the arrests of 2 New York City men and the seizure of crack cocaine and $12,000 in cash. Ogdensburg Police Department Narcotics Enforcement Unit stopped a vehicle on Route 812 in the town of Oswegatchie last Friday. According to police, a K9 sniffed out drugs, leading authorities to find more than 8 ounces of crack cocaine and over $12,000 in cash inside the vehicle.
